**Q: Why did my experiment bucket change between requests?**

A: Splitjar assignment is deterministic per user-key, not per session. Bucket flips mean the key changed upstream — check the hashing middleware, not the allocator. Reviewers: reject any patch touching the salt. To replay assignments against the sealed audit log, use the recovery passphrase below.

strongbox words: sorir-belvan-rusix-ulays-ralmir-praix-eliir-tamax-praael-druael-julir-tamius-jorir

- [ ] Step 7: Archive cold storage buckets (Glacierline tier). Confirm both ceremony witnesses are present, verify bucket manifests match the Oxbow ledger, then seal the archive key shares. Plugin authors may observe but not handle shares. Once sealed, the archive index itself is encrypted and can only be reopened with the passphrase below.

vault phrase of badup-hahig = tamael-aldael-kelmir-istael-fenok-istwyn-tamius-jorath-oliion

Quarterly Planning Note — Sales Leads

The licensing dispute with Brackwell Systems over the Fennic Suite remains unresolved. Until counsel advises otherwise, do not quote Fennic modules to new prospects in the Halden territory; existing contracts are unaffected. Pipeline targets for the quarter shift accordingly toward the Larkspur line. Expect a ruling update mid-quarter. The confidential summary of our fallback commercial plans is set out immediately below.

confidential, kagep-kahof: Druokax Systems plans to lower the Ulaath list price by 53 percent in March.

Ticket: PIXL-4471 — Config drift on EXIF scrubber

The Quillshade EXIF scrubbing workers in the east pool are running different settings than the west pool. East is stripping GPS tags but leaving orientation and maker notes intact, which violates our scrub policy. Likely cause: a manual hotfix last month that never made it into the template. For comparison, the west pool's current values are:

config for tagep-yajef:
ulawyn:
  log_level: error
  metrics_host: metrics.ulawyn.lumiclabs.internal
  pin: 0564
  pool_size: 32